The EAxis store has just released two new objects for infants that should have been part of Apartment Life but evidently they kept them out so they could charge the fans again later. The Awesome place already have them and obviously, I wanted to try them out as soon as possible :).
Problem is that none of my Brokes have infant children at the moment, and Gen 6 is still a little bit away (but it's coming soon... or so I hope!). So, I had to give the honor of trying these new toys to a different family.
